AdS/CFT Correspondence and Quotient Space Geometry
We consider a version of the correspondence, in which the
bulk space is taken to be the quotient manifold with a
fairly generic discrete group acting isometrically on . We
address some geometrical issues concerning the holographic principle and the
UV/IR relations. It is shown that certain singular structures on the quotient
boundary can affect the underlying physical spectrum. In
particular, the conformal dimension of the most relevant operators in the
boundary CFT can increase as becomes ``large''. This phenomenon also
has a natural explanation in terms of the bulk supergravity theory. The scalar
two-point function is computed using this quotient version of the AdS/CFT
correspondence, which agrees with the expected result derived from conformal
